Let's talk about resetting:
Run cmd
Set ORACLE_SID = ORCL % service name %
Set oracle_hostname = host name % prevent failed resolution %
Emca-config dbcontrol db-repos recreate
% Enter various information. After successful completion, check listener. ora (under the oracle main directory \ network \ ADMIN \) and comment this (PROGRAM = extproc) %
SID_LIST_LISTENER =
(SID_LIST =
(SID_DESC =
(SID_NAME = prod)
(ORACLE_HOME =/u01/app/oracle/product/10.2.0/db_1)
# (PROGRAM = extproc)
)
)
Check the listening address of the net manager and the configuration of the net configuration assistant. Make sure that the ip address is the same. Restart the listener (directly restart services. msc)
